Well, thing is lads, it wouldn't just be a name change. They would change the badge, club colours, and even try to delete your previous history and claim it was a new club, as they did when they took over Austria Salzburg. The new owners even took the step of banning fans from entering the stadium wearing their old colours.

I have a lot of respect for what the fans of Austria Salzburg did. They turned up at a Red Bull game, and in the 10th minute of the match, staged a mass walk out and never returned. They have since formed a new club, using the old badge that they purchased from Red Bull, and have built their way up the leagues after starting at the very bottom, and are currently sitting top of the Regionalliga West, the third tier of Austrian football. They won the league last season, but lost out on promotion in the play-offs, but look destined to reach the Bundesliga in the next few years.
